White fused alumina (WFA) is a high-grade abrasive material that is widely used in various industrial applications. Some of the key properties of WFA include:
Hardness: WFA is a very hard material, with a Mohs hardness of 9. This makes it an excellent abrasive material that can be used for grinding and cutting hard materials such as metals and ceramics.
High melting point: WFA has a very high melting point, typically around 2,050°C. This property makes it ideal for use in high-temperature applications such as refractory linings for furnaces and kilns.
Chemical stability: WFA is chemically inert, meaning that it does not react with most substances. This property makes it suitable for use in harsh chemical environments, such as in the manufacture of chemicals and pharmaceuticals.
Low thermal expansion: WFA has a low thermal expansion coefficient, which means that it does not expand or contract significantly with changes in temperature. This property makes it ideal for use in precision engineering applications where dimensional stability is critical.
High purity: WFA is typically very pure, with a minimum purity level of 99.5%. This property makes it suitable for use in high-tech applications such as semiconductors and electronics.
